Responsibilities
Modern/Contemporary Dance Technique Class Accompanist
- Improvise music to match tempo, meter, musicality, and length of dance exercises or combinations given by the instructor
- Play alone or occasionally with another musician
- Provide music based on 20th and 21st century concert dance techniques and styles (e.g., Graham, Horton, Limón)
- Use a personalized style that complements the dance movement, often through spontaneous improvisation
- Communicate effectively with the teacher, adjusting tempo or music choices as requested
- Maintain consistent and precise tempos, adapting to changes as needed
- Play odd meters or change meter mid-exercise when required
- Provide textural, non-rhythmic, or timbral-focused sounds when needed
Ballet Technique Class Accompanist
- Play repertoire of your choosing or improvise (primarily in classical styles, but other styles may be included) to match ballet exercises
- Edit repertoire as needed to fit the length and phrasing of exercises
- Provide a clear sense of beat, pulse, and timing for dancers
- Use rubato appropriately in certain exercises
- Communicate effectively with the teacher, adjusting tempo or music choices as requested

Studio Environment and Protocols
- Most studios are equipped with acoustic pianos (primarily Yamaha U1s, with one concert grand); some smaller studios have digital pianos
- Accompanists generally do not speak during class except to ask for clarification or when approached by the teacher
- Water is allowed in class, but containers should not be placed on pianos
